Steelers, Saint Vincent College looking for training camp employees
LATROBE (KDKA) - The weather is getting warmer, the sun is shining a little longer, and that can only mean one thing - Steelers Training Camp is just a couple of months away. Next week, a hiring event is set to take place at the Fred M. Rogers Center on Saint Vincent College's campus from 10 a.m. until 2 p.m. on May 8 for those interested in working at Steelers Training Camp. All of the positions are part-time and temporary. Steelers Training Camp dates have not yet been solidified but it is expected to go from mid-July through August and shift times as well as responsibilities will be discussed during the interviews. All applicants must be 18, complete a background check, and have reliable transportation to and from Saint Vincent College. Once hired, employees will be required to work rain or shine and wear a uniform that includes a Steelers Training Camp shirt which will be provided, khakis or black pants, and flat closed-toe shoes. Hundreds of thousands descending on Pittsburgh for Marathon this weekend
The Pittsburgh Marathon is the largest sporting event of the year in the city between runners and spectators. Tory Schooley, CEO of P3R, Tells the Big K Morning Show there is a record number of participants this year, over 42,000 runners.
